I don't think I'm ready for the melting pot blast furnace yet. <img src="/forums/images/graemlins/lol.gif" alt="" />
I thought I'd just get a good-sized chunk and cut away on it, but as much as the price has gone up, I recalculated for less waste. I think I can work with a piece as small as 3"x8"x15"... haven't priced it yet, but it should be a lot less. <img src="/forums/images/graemlins/kewl.gif" alt="" /> Before I commit to the aluminum block size, I want to receive the MP62 case to measure the volume in the discharge port - which will be deducted from the plenum volume requirement. I'm guessing there's about 15-25cid in the discharge port, but I'm not sure. Magnauson was trying to ship the replacement unit today via UPS overnight - we'll see.
Unfortunately, the machine shop I'm using will be closed from June 10th until June 24th so the owner can go to a national hot rod show somewhere.... won't be able to cut the piece now until late this month... that's ok - I can use the time for further planning/checking/rechecking/what-iff-ing/s'posing.

So, after plunking down $298 for a block of 6016, it was back home to find an MP62 housing waiting for me. <img src="/forums/images/graemlins/kewl.gif" alt="" /> I disassembled the MP45, swapped the bearing plate and nose drive onto the MP62 housing and started final fit on blower location and plenum sizing. I reduced the height of the plenum to 1.00": ![[Linked Image]](http://i72.imagethrust.com/t/81017/img2899.jpg) Located the blower: ![[Linked Image]](http://i72.imagethrust.com/t/81018/img2900.jpg) Checked to see if I was in the ballpark for this belt (fingers crossed): ![[Linked Image]](http://i72.imagethrust.com/t/81019/img2901.jpg) Calculated the volume in the MP62 discharge port - it's 25.0 cid: ![[Linked Image]](http://i72.imagethrust.com/t/81021/img2903.jpg) Added the volume in the discharge port to the volume in the plenum and glued in some sticks to adjust the final volume to proper size as suggested by Helmholtz Resonator Theory - total plenum/discharge port volume is now 91.5 cid - exactly 1/2 of 183 cid engine displacement: ![[Linked Image]](http://i72.imagethrust.com/t/81023/img2906.jpg) Rear views: ![[Linked Image]](http://i72.imagethrust.com/t/81024/img2907.jpg) Front view: ![[Linked Image]](http://i72.imagethrust.com/t/81025/img2911.jpg) The idler pulleys should arrive soon, so the next session should see an idler pulley bracket/nose drive brace mock-up... if the belt and pulleys will work together as planned. Dang it..... looks like the throttle body is gonna have to move to the driver side after all. There's just not enough room on the passenger side and no way the cables will make the turns to the throttle hookup. Lots of work ahead. <img src="/forums/images/graemlins/rolleyes.gif" alt="" />

It looks like a 72.0" belt should work ok with either a single or double idler pulley arrangement.... <img src="/forums/images/graemlins/kewl.gif" alt="" /> The next size that I've found is a 75.5" (too long).... a 73.0-74.0" would be better - if I can find one - since it would give a little more wrap on the fan and alternator pulleys: ![[Linked Image]](http://i72.imagethrust.com/t/84241/img2917.jpg) Frank
